Who was one of the first people to identify and observe cells from cork?

Respuesta :

AlterEQO
AlterEQO AlterEQO
  • 03-12-2020

Answer:

The first person to observe cells was Robert Hooke. Hooke was an English scientist. He used a compound microscope to look at thin slices of cork.
